If I had a spyder and it broke would I have to worry about whether or not they would fix or replace it? I was told their service isnt really the best.

ALSO, Im planning to order my gun online and they want you to send the card that comes with the gun back to them with your receipt if you want to have a warranty...but what would be the receipt?

Usually a printout of the order confirmation or shipping E-mail is sufficient. In my experience though most companies will give you repair support without sending the warrenty card in.

They could very well be different then what I've experienced. A lot of times if you don't send the card in, they will go by the manufacturing date for the item. As long as it hasn't been sitting on a shelf somewhere you should be gold. The only way to find out is to call them and see what they'll do.

I have another question..since this will be my first gun I dont know all the basics yet. How exactly can a gun break anyways?

Various reasons. Lack of oiling, Leaks, Some were even craked in half due to abuse, scratches, and various other bad things that all can be fixed.

Basic upkeep is easy. Cleaning the marker after evry game. The longer version and more better way to do it is this.... You have to take all the internals out, every single bit. Mostlikely you hacked a ball and there is paint resedue in the barrell and in the body. What I do is soak the boddy in soapy water and "scrub" the inside with a cloth barrell cleaner and do this to the barrell to. THis also simeltaneously cleans the squegge.

Once done dry the body and the barrell. THen bathe the rest off the barts and wipe them down in order to prevent corosion.

Next lightly oil the parts (this also is a flux to prevent rusty and corroded parts which rarely happens even in badly treated spyders.). Re assemble the marker and your done.


Now the eaier way to do this is simply take off the internals and wipe everything down and with a squeege run it through the body frame and do the same for the barrell. Wipe the the bolt of paint and dirt and do the same with the other internals. Then oil and reassemble.


Note for the therough version of upkeep you have to take the valve out inorder to clean the lower part. However the through version is more for the experianced player that knows his way around a gun.

i once owned a spyder victor... and in the middle of a game the plastic trigger frame exploded. the little pin that keeps the valve in just flew out and shot through the trigger frame, causing plastic shrapnel to go everywhere. Also, since the body no longer had solid contact with the sear, my victor started shooting at like 100000000 bps. And, not wanting to leave the game, i tied it together with a kids barrel condom, right in the middle of a game.... yeah, victor trigger frames suck.

Kingman's customer service is one of the best in the industry. You can call and talk to a service tech, and 9 times out of 10 they will diagnose the problem on the first phone call. If there is a new part involved, they can order that shipped to you right away as well.

I have nothing but praise for Kingman and thier customer service.
